Q: What is Massey Ferguson?
A: Massey Ferguson is a brand of agricultural equipment, including tractors, combine harvesters, balers, and more. It is a well-established name in the farming community, known for its quality and durability.
Q: Who makes Massey Ferguson subcompact tractors?
A: Massey Ferguson subcompact tractors are manufactured by AGCO Corporation, a global leader in the design, manufacture, and distribution of agricultural equipment.
AGCO Corporation
AGCO Corporation is a Fortune 500 company based in Duluth, Georgia, USA. It was founded in 1990 and has since grown to become one of the largest manufacturers of agricultural equipment in the world. AGCO operates under various brand names, including Massey Ferguson, Challenger, Fendt, and Valtra.
